Book of Reference to the Plans of the Scottish Southern Railway, 1845

The Book of Reference to the Plans of the Scottish Railway contains the "names of the owners or reputed owners, lessees or reputed lessees and occupiers" of the lands that the proposed railway line will take to Drummore.  It passes through the parishes of Inch, Stoneykirk and Kirkmaiden.  Unfortunately this project was never completed.
